Sirin A. Adham is a scholar working on Molecular Biology, Oncology and Nephrology. According to data from OpenAlex, Sirin A. Adham has authored 41 papers receiving a total of 937 indexed citations (citations by other indexed papers that have themselves been cited), including 20 papers in Molecular Biology, 7 papers in Oncology and 6 papers in Nephrology. Recurrent topics in Sirin A. Adham's work include Angiogenesis and VEGF in Cancer (10 papers), Cancer Cells and Metastasis (6 papers) and Statistical Distribution Estimation and Applications (4 papers). Sirin A. Adham is often cited by papers focused on Angiogenesis and VEGF in Cancer (10 papers), Cancer Cells and Metastasis (6 papers) and Statistical Distribution Estimation and Applications (4 papers). Sirin A. Adham collaborates with scholars based in Oman, Canada and United Arab Emirates. Sirin A. Adham's co-authors include Brenda L. Coomber, Abderrahim Nemmar, Badreldin H. Ali, Mohammed Al Za’abi, Ifat Sher, Mostafa I. Waly, Suhail Al‐Salam, José A. Gil, Jim Petrik and Nicole Schupp and has published in prestigious journals such as PLoS ONE, Applied and Environmental Microbiology and Cancer Research.
